    Civic Offices, Guildhall Square, Portsmouth, PO1 2AL: Council's main offices. The council meets at Portsmouth Guildhall, in Guildhall Square. [37] The building was completed in 1890 for the old borough council. [38] The council's main offices are the Civic Offices, which were erected to the east of the guildhall and completed in 1976.     The Bournemouth Symphony Orchestra (BSO [1]) is an English orchestra, founded in 1893 and originally based in Bournemouth.With a remit to serve the South and South West of England, the BSO is administratively based in the adjacent town of Poole, since 1979. [2]
